]> gcc.gnu.org Git - gcc.git/commit - gcc/testsuite/ChangeLog
re PR tree-optimization/27283 (ICE: SSA corruption - Conflict across an abnormal...
authorZdenek Dvorak <dvorakz@suse.cz>
Mon, 1 May 2006 20:05:57 +0000 (22:05 +0200)
committerZdenek Dvorak <rakdver@gcc.gnu.org>
Mon, 1 May 2006 20:05:57 +0000 (20:05 +0000)
commitdcccd88d389e79d2b8ea7675e0cbc90c0d8c84df
treec23066a00dcce02ea7bc2323eb29f97eb1070b42
parenta5dfac10a2ec09de7b9763226161dfc90a2a259d
re PR tree-optimization/27283 (ICE: SSA corruption - Conflict across an abnormal edge)

PR tree-optimization/27283
* tree-ssa-loop-ivopts.c (struct nfe_cache_elt): Store just trees,
not whole # of iteration descriptions.
(niter_for_exit): Return just # of iterations.  Fail if # of iterations
uses abnormal ssa name.
(niter_for_single_dom_exit): Ditto.
(find_induction_variables, may_eliminate_iv): Expect niter_for_exit to
return just the number of iterations.

* g++.dg/tree-ssa/pr27283.C: New test.

From-SVN: r113427
gcc/ChangeLog
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/tree-ssa/pr27283.C [new file with mode: 0644]
gcc/tree-ssa-loop-ivopts.c
This page took 0.061107 seconds and 5 git commands to generate.